(SHOWBIZ CHEAT SHEET) -- There’s a major conflict over which is the best Christmas movie of them all. It’s true that movie watchers have so many options to choose from — classic selections like It’s a Wonderful Life to modern comedies such as Elf. But even with the hundreds of Christmas movies for your viewing pleasure, there are two that stand out above the rest.
A Christmas Story (1983) is one of the most popular films to watch each December. It’s such a beloved pick that TBS and TNT both air it continuously for 24 hours straight beginning Christmas Eve. But many holiday movie watchers are enamored by National Lampoon’s Christmas Vacation (1989). These dueling groups both think their pick is the best of the best.
So, which is superior: A Christmas Story or Christmas Vacation? There’s an easy way to find out.
